What are the most common Audi repair issues seen by shops in Norwich, CT, due to our local climate and roads?

Norwich's cold winters and road salt heavily contribute to premature wear of suspension components like control arms and wheel bearings. Additionally, local mechanics frequently address oil leaks from the valve cover gaskets and PCV system, which are common on many Audi models, as well as electrical issues related to moisture intrusion.

Are Audi repair costs in Norwich generally higher than for other brands, and what's a typical price for routine maintenance?

Yes, due to specialized parts and technology, Audi repairs are typically more expensive than non-luxury brands. For example, a standard Audi service (oil change, inspection) in Norwich can range from $200-$400, while major services like a timing belt replacement can exceed $1,500, depending on the model.

When should I seek immediate service from a Norwich-area Audi specialist for a warning light?

Seek immediate service for the red oil pressure or coolant temperature warning lights, as these can indicate catastrophic engine damage. For yellow check engine or ESP/ABS lights, schedule a prompt diagnostic, as they could relate to emissions, sensors, or critical safety systems, especially important for handling on wet or icy local roads.

What local considerations should Norwich Audi owners have for seasonal maintenance?

Before winter, have your battery and charging system tested, as cold starts are demanding, and ensure the Quattro all-wheel-drive system is serviced for optimal traction on icy roads. In spring, a thorough undercarriage wash to remove corrosive salt and a brake inspection after harsh winter driving are highly recommended by local shops.
